Cheapest Available State College 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of February 25, 2026 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in State College, PA is the 1 BR HCP/WC Accessible Model starting from $943 at Centre Estates I & II . The second most affordable State College 1 Bedroom is the 1 Bedroom, 1 Bath Model at Brickwork Properties Communities starting at $1,198 . The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in State College is currently $1,556.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in State College:

State College Overview

State College is a metropolitan town situated in Centre County, Pennsylvania. It?s home to The Pennsylvania State University?s Park Campus, which largely forms its economic and demographic patterns. It is more than just a college town with vibrant nightlife, recreational facilities, shopping outlets, and good quality apartments that make it a great place to live.

Why live in State College, PA?

State College is a wonderful place to live and raise a family because of low crime rates, great schools, and ambient recreational facilities around the mountains. The town is built around Pennsylvania State University with steady college amenities and sporting activities. Though the unemployment rate is slightly higher than that of the national average, State College has experienced a significant job growth rate. It is also isolated from the commotion of the larger cities, with a reasonable cost of living and housing.
